Does caffeine help period cramps?
If you’re wondering, “Does coffee help period cramps?” the short answer is: no. Caffeine blocks a hormone that can make blood vessels (which are present in the uterus) smaller, slowing the flow of blood. Coffee can also cause inflammation and bloating, adding to tummy pain. So, drinking coffee can make cramps worse.

What medicine helps with period cramps?
Over-the-counter pain relievers, such as 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in IB, others) or naproxen sodium (Aleve), at regular doses starting the day before you expect your period to begin can help control the pain of cramps. Prescription n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s also are available.

Does Midol stop your period?
A: Anti-inflammatories like ibuprofen and naproxen reduce the production of prostaglandins. Prostaglandins are chemicals that trigger the uterus to contract and shed the endometrium (uterine lining) each month. However, anti-inflammatories can delay your period for no more than a day or two.

Is Midol or Advil better for cramps?
One of the first reflexes to appease stomach cramps is to run to the pharmacy and purchase an analgesic. But which one should you choose? Although acetaminophen (Tylenol) and ibuprofen (Motrin or Advil) both relieve menstrual pain, ibuprofen is the more effective of the two because of its anti-inflammatory properties.

Will Midol keep me awake?
A pair of Midol Menstrual Maximum Strength caplets could contain 65 mg of caffeine. So if you happen to get a little happy with your pill-popping, you could potentially exceed your stimulant quota — particularly if you’re also downing a venti latte at the same time.

Does Midol help with lower back pain?
Available in convenient and easy to take caplets, Midol Complete contains acetaminophen with caffeine and pyrilamine maleate, combining a pain reliever, diuretic and antihistamine to effectively relieve period cramps, headache, backache, muscle ache, bloating, fatigue and water weight gain.
How much ibuprofen is in Midol?
Each tablet contains Ibuprofen 200 mg. Non-Steroidal Anti-Inflammatory/Analgesic. For the relief of minor aches and pains associated with the menstrual cycle like headache, muscular aches, back aches and menstrual cramps.
